Examining the relationship of e-service quality, customer satisfaction and customer loyalty perceived in internet shopping: An application on Adıyaman University students

Abstract (EN)

Developments in technology, the fact that information is spreading very quickly, and the increasing concentration of competition has increased dramatically in internet use. The increase in internet use has also made some changes in consumer buying habits. Online shopping and electronic commerce (e-commerce) has become very important to both businesses and consumers. In particular, consumers' awareness, desire and needs have changed, and with consumers taking less time tos hop online, instead of travelling around long stores and shopping, they have forced businesses tı change their marketing approach and switch to virtual makets. This change has resulted in a sense of online shopping and electronic commerce. With this work, online purchases have been identified by the quality of –service customers perceive as a result of their experiences with goods and services, identifying customer satisfaction and customer loyalty levels and resulting in results that could be useful to businesses. This study is intended to examine the relationship between the quality of e-service, customer satisfaction and customer loyalty detected on internet purchases based on Adıyaman University students. The online survey method was used as a data collection technique. 453 surveys have been obtained for research. 55 valid surveys have been subtracted because 398 people have not been online shopping. According to the findings obtained from the research, the quality of e-service detected in internet purchases has been concluded to be a positive and meaningful relationship between customer satisfaction and customer loyalty.
